We'd love to meet you

Register your interest in our upcoming opportunities

Register Interest

Engineering @ Solirius

Your Routine

  • Interesting projects
  • Central location
  • Bright and modern office
  • Work from home days

Our Culture

  • Passionate about technology
  • Friendly team
  • Supportive environment
  • Company retreats

Your Health

  • Work/life balance
  • Subsidised gym
  • Inclusive environment
  • Helpful management

Our Tech Stack

Register your interest in our upcoming opportunities

Register Interest

Our Roles

Senior Software Engineer (Java/JavaScript Specialism)

We look to our senior software engineers as members of our A-team. They are experts in their field: fundamental to the design, development and delivery of software solutions. They provide support to other members of the software team.

In this role, you will act as both a senior software engineer and a lead consultant. You will be working in an established consultancy, operating in both private and public sectors.

We look to our senior software engineers as members of our A-team. They are experts in their field: fundamental to the design, development and delivery of software solutions. They provide support to other members of the software team.

In this role, you will act as both a senior software engineer and a lead consultant. You will be working in an established consultancy, operating in both private and public sectors.

Job Duties:

  • Develop high-quality software design and low level architecture designs
  • Identify, prioritise and execute tasks in the software development life-cycle
  • Develop tools and applications by producing clean, efficient code
  • Automate tasks through appropriate tools and scripting
  • Review and debug code
  • Perform validation and verification testing
  • Collaborate with internal teams and partners to fix and improve products
  • Document development phases and monitor systems
  • Ensure software is up-to-date with latest technologies

Skills:

  • Analysing information
  • Software design
  • Software documentation
  • Software testing
  • Teamwork
  • General programming skills
  • Software development fundamentals
  • Software development process
  • Software requirements
  • Software architecture patterns
  • Coaching

Experience:

  • Minimum of 3 to 5 years of development experience
  • Applied experience of selected application frameworks (Spring, Angular 2+, Ruby on Rails)
  • Deep knowledge of selected programming languages (either Java, JavaScript, Python or Ruby)
  • Deep knowledge of relational and non-relational databases (e.g PostgreSQL, MySQL, MongoDB)
  • Solid understanding of various operating systems (Linux, Mac OS, Windows)
  • Familiarity with automating infrastructure provisioning using Ansible or Docker Containers
  • Analytical mind with problem-solving aptitude
  • Ability to work independently
  • Excellent organizational and leadership skills

Email your CV to careers@solirius.com ref: Senior Software Engineer

Software Engineer (Java/JavaScript/Python/Ruby Specialism)

As a software engineer you will form a fundamental part of our teams. You will be a technology enthusiast with a drive to design, develop and deliver "clean" code and software applications. You will have an excellent knowledge of at least one programming language and be familiar with a variety of operating systems and platforms.

In this role, you will act as both a software engineer and technical consultant. You will be working in an established consultancy, operating in both private and public sectors.

As a software engineer you will form a fundamental part of our teams. You will be a technology enthusiast with a drive to design, develop and deliver "clean" code and software applications. You will have an excellent knowledge of at least one programming language and be familiar with a variety of operating systems and platforms.

In this role, you will act as both a software engineer and technical consultant. You will be working in an established consultancy, operating in both private and public sectors.

Job Duties:

  • Understand client requirements and how they translate into application features
  • Collaborate with members of your team to break features into stories
  • Design working prototypes according to specifications
  • Write high quality source code to program complete applications within deadlines
  • Perform unit and integration testing before launch
  • Conduct functional and non-functional testing
  • Troubleshoot and debug applications
  • Evaluate existing applications to refactor, update and add new features
  • Develop technical documents and handbooks to accurately represent application design and code

Skills:

  • Analysing information
  • Software design
  • Software documentation
  • Software testing
  • Teamwork
  • General programming skills
  • Software development fundamentals
  • Software development process
  • Software requirements
  • Software architecture patterns

Experience:

  • Minimum of 1 year of development experience
  • Applied experience of at least one selected application framework (Spring, Angular 2+ or Ruby on Rails)
  • Understanding and ability in at least one programming language (either Java, JavaScript, Python or Ruby)
  • Understanding and use of relational and non-relational databases (e.g PostgreSQL, MySQL, MongoDB)
  • Solid understanding of various operating systems (Linux, Mac OS, Windows)
  • Familiarity with automating infrastructure provisioning using Ansible or Docker Containers
  • Analytical mind with problem-solving aptitude
  • Ability to work independently
  • Excellent organizational and communication skills

Email your CV to careers@solirius.com ref: Software Engineer

Front End Developer (JavaScript/HTML/CSS Specialism)

As a front-end developer, you will provide the creative edge to our development teams. You will be a budding technology enthusiast with a drive to help design, develop and deliver software solutions focused on the end user. You will have an eye for good design and a strong desire to create beautiful interfaces for the web, mobile and desktop.

Fulfilling this role, you will act as both a front-end developer and a creative consultant. You will work closely with the UX team in an established consultancy, operating in both private and public sectors.

As a front-end developer, you will provide the creative edge to our development teams. You will be a budding technology enthusiast with a drive to help design, develop and deliver software solutions focused on the end user. You will have an eye for good design and a strong desire to create beautiful interfaces for the web, mobile and desktop.

Fulfilling this role, you will act as both a front-end developer and a creative consultant. You will work closely with the UX team in an established consultancy, operating in both private and public sectors.

Job Duties:

  • Understand client requirements and how they translate into presentational features
  • Collaborate with members of your team to break features into stories
  • Design working prototypes according to specifications
  • Write high quality source code to program complete applications within deadlines
  • Perform unit and integration testing before launch
  • Conduct functional and non-functional testing
  • Troubleshoot and debug applications
  • Evaluate existing applications to refactor, update and add new features
  • Develop technical documents and handbooks to accurately represent application design and code

Skills:

  • Analysing information
  • Creative design
  • Software design
  • Software documentation
  • Software testing
  • Teamwork
  • General programming skills
  • Software development fundamentals
  • Software development process
  • Software requirements
  • Software architecture patterns

Experience:

  • Minimum of 1 year of development experience
  • Applied experience of at least one selected application framework (Spring, Angular 2+ or Ruby on Rails)
  • Understanding and ability in at least one programming language (either Java, JavaScript, Python or Ruby)
  • Understanding and use of relational and non-relational databases (e.g PostgreSQL, MySQL, MongoDB)
  • Solid understanding of various operating systems (Linux, Mac OS, Windows)
  • Familiarity with automating infrastructure provisioning using Ansible or Docker Containers
  • Analytical mind with problem-solving aptitude
  • Ability to work independently
  • Excellent organizational and communication skills

Email your CV to careers@solirius.com ref: Front End Developer